Starting in Zagreb early in the morning, this tour kicks off with a comfortable drive toward Slovenia’s famous Postojna Cave. Known for its vast tunnels, galleries, and stalactites, the cave is a natural marvel that has drawn visitors for centuries. The official description emphasizes the “fantastic web of tunnels” and “easy access,” making it suitable for most visitors, including those with moderate mobility. We loved the way the cave’s diversity of Karst features highlights the geological wonders of the region.

The cave tour itself is often described as impressive—and probably the highlight for many. We appreciated the guided narration that brought the underground world to life, explaining the formations and history. Although you’ll need to purchase tickets to enter (€29), the tour’s inclusion in the overall price makes it straightforward, with a skip-the-line advantage that saves time.

Next, the journey continues to Lake Bled, arguably Slovenia’s most iconic spot. The sight of the medieval Bled Castle perched high above the lake is breathtaking, and the views of the Alpine peaks surrounding the water are truly postcard-worthy. You’ll have time to enjoy the scenery, walk around the lakeshore, and visit the tiny island with its church—a popular photography spot. An optional visit to Bled Castle (€17) is available, but it’s not included in the base price. We enjoyed a leisurely stroll, soaking in the peaceful atmosphere and snapping photos of the church steeple rising from the water.

A delightful surprise is tasting Kremnita, a traditional Slovenian dessert—a vanilla custard and cream cake—that offers a sweet break amid the day’s sightseeing. This is a nice cultural touch that adds flavor to the overall experience.

Finally, the tour winds down in Ljubljana, Slovenia’s charming capital. Starting at the Town Hall, you’ll walk through the city’s historic center, admiring its blend of Baroque and Art Nouveau architecture. The guide’s insights about Joe Plenik’s modernist buildings add depth to your stroll. The Triple Bridge, Dragon Bridge, and the lively markets are highlights. The funicular ride up to Ljubljana Castle provides a panoramic view of the city and the river below—a perfect spot for a final photo. Concluding with a walk along the Ljubljanica River, you’ll get a genuine feel for the city’s vibrant yet relaxed atmosphere.
